Orienteering race 57:30 [4]10.5 km (5:29 / km)
shoes: Ascis Gel GT 2110
SHAFF race around the centre of Sheffield. A bit tired, windy, Saturday afternoon shoppers and match goers were my excuses! Good fun though. Got a good route without hardly any planning and only had trouble finding a few answers. One gate was locked by St George's church so not sure that I got the correct answer there and I'm not sure that I got the height right at No.3. Made a mess of routes to the controls around the Peace Gardens and Fargate and some of the routes were blocked off, probably about a minute of faffing. Route here for anyone who has run it already:
